Output 3ba51a66295ef8d13afad3c48874ce8eeedbc47ffe826a5faf6ec7e8c7218672:50

value
149142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58a16c423c98419fc3b7237592435d9b1992c79 OP_EQUAL
address
3Q5Ju8TC7ANEfm4djKwfjaqJdn2yE9Rs8Y
transaction
3ba51a66295ef8d13afad3c48874ce8eeedbc47ffe826a5faf6ec7e8c7218672